3550 Commits (6959a363f0ba8d0e8b05442f4c8f3cc4a2e00ca6)
 

Author SHA1 Message Date
Aakansha Doshi 2f9526da24
feat: upgrade to mermaid-to-excalidraw v1 🚀 (#8022) 2 years ago
David Luzar 1b6e3fe05b
feat: rerender canvas on focus (#8035) 2 years ago
VatsalSoni_13 afe52c89a7
fix: undo/redo when exiting view mode (#8024) 2 years ago
zsviczian be4e127f6c
fix: Two finger panning is slow (#7849) 2 years ago
Karthik Nishanth ff0b4394b1
feat: add missing `type="button"` (#8030) 2 years ago
Hey 7d8b7fc14d
fix: compatible safari layers button svg (#8020) 2 years ago
Ryan Di 971b4d4ae6
feat: text wrapping (#7999) 2 years ago
David Luzar cc4c51996c
build: specify `packageManager` field (#8010) 2 years ago
Guillaume Grossetie 79257a1923
fix: correctly resolve the package version (#8016) 2 years ago
Marcel Mraz dc66261c19
fix: re-introduce wysiwyg width offset (#8014) 2 years ago
David Luzar 273ba803d9
fix: font not rendered correctly on init (#8002) 2 years ago
David Luzar 301e83805d
feat: add install-PWA to command palette (#7935) 2 years ago
David Luzar ed5ce8d3de
fix: command palette filter (#7981) 2 years ago
Aakansha Doshi 1ed53b153c
build: enable consistent type imports eslint rule (#7992) 2 years ago
Aakansha Doshi c1926f33bb
fix: remove unused param from drawImagePlaceholder (#7991) 2 years ago
Andreas Gebhardt 6539029d2a
fix: docker build of Excalidraw app (#7430) 2 years ago
David Luzar d1f37cc64f
feat: tweak a few icons & add line editor button to side panel (#7990) 2 years ago
Márk Tolmács f0d25e34c3
chore: Add lcov coverage output to vitest (#7987) 2 years ago
Márk Tolmács d9bbf1eda6
feat: Allow binding only via linear element ends (#7946) 2 years ago
Márk Tolmács f79fb9aae2
chore: Bump vitest to 1.5.3 to support VSCode vitest Extension (#7968) 2 years ago
Mritunjay Goutam 275f6fbe24
fix: typo in doc api (#7466) 2 years ago
Ryan Di 88812e0386
feat: resize elements from the sides (#7855) 2 years ago
Marcel Mraz 6e5aeb112d
feat: record freedraw tool selection to history (#7949) 2 years ago
Marcel Mraz 4d83d1c91e
fix: use Reflect API instead of Object.hasOwn (#7958) 2 years ago
Márk Tolmács a04676d423
fix: CTRL/CMD & arrow point drag unbinds both sides (#6459) (#7877) 2 years ago
Milos Vetesnik c851aaaf7b
fix: z-index for laser pointer to be able to draw on embeds and such (#7918) 2 years ago
Marcel Mraz 1bd2b1fe55
feat: export reconciliation (#7917) 2 years ago
Marcel Mraz 015b46ab23
feat: expose `StoreAction` in relation to multiplayer history (#7898) 2 years ago
Marcel Mraz 530617be90
feat: multiplayer undo / redo (#7348) 2 years ago
David Luzar 5211b003b8
fix: double text rendering on edit (#7904) 2 years ago
Ryan Di bbcca06b94
fix: collision regressions from vector geometry rewrite (#7902) 2 years ago
johnd99 f92f04c13c
fix: Correct unit from 'eg' to 'deg' (#7891) 2 years ago
David Luzar 890ed9f31f
feat: add "toggle grid" to command palette (#7887) 2 years ago
David Luzar da2e507298
fix: allow same origin for all necessary domains (#7889) 2 years ago
David Luzar f59b4f6af4
fix: always make sure we render bound text above containers (#7880) 2 years ago
David Luzar afcde542f9
fix: parse embeddable srcdoc urls strictly (#7884) 2 years ago
Ryan Di 4689a6b300
fix: hit test for closed sharp curves (#7881) 2 years ago
David Luzar 0ae9b383d6
fix: Gist embed allowing unsafe html (#7883) 2 years ago
David Luzar f597bd3e01
fix: command palette tweaks and fixes (#7876) 2 years ago
Ryan Di 4987cc53d0
fix: include borders when testing insides of a shape (#7865) 2 years ago
Rinku Chaudhari d917db438e
fix: external link not opening (#7859) 2 years ago
Aakansha Doshi a33a400f01
fix: add safe check for arrow points length in tranformToExcalidrawElements (#7863) 2 years ago
David Luzar 8a162a4cb4
fix: import (#7869) 2 years ago
David Luzar c6a045d092
fix: theme toggle shortcut `event.code` (#7868) 2 years ago
Arnost Pleskot cd50aa719f
feat: add system mode to the theme selector (#7853) 2 years ago
David Luzar 92bc08207c
fix: remove incorrect check from index.html (#7867) 2 years ago
Ryan Di 32df5502ae
feat: fractional indexing (#7359) 2 years ago
Ryan Di bbdcd30a73
refactor: update collision from ga to vector geometry (#7636) 2 years ago
David Luzar 3e334a67ed
feat: show firefox-compatible command palette shortcut alias (#7825) 2 years ago
David Luzar 1d71f84515
fix: stop using lookbehind for backwards compat (#7824) 2 years ago